Mechanism of Action
This extract functions by suppressing the pathways responsible for inflammatory stress, specifically inhibiting pro-inflammatory cytokines such as IL-6 and TNF-alpha. Its rich flavonoid profile neutralizes free radicals via DPPH and ABTS scavenging, while its natural chemical constituents disrupt the integrity of bacterial cell membranes to manage blemish-prone environments.

Key findings
- 01 Observed significant reduction in acne and eczema symptoms over a 14-day local application period at 1% concentration.
- 02 Demonstrated Minimum Inhibitory Concentration (MIC) against Staphylococcus strains (MRSA/MRSE) at levels between 0.21% and 0.28%.

Dusting Analysis
Because botanical extracts are often marketed for 'storytelling,' many formulations include this at negligible levels (below 0.1%). To achieve the documented antimicrobial and anti-inflammatory benefits seen in 2023-2025 research, a minimum concentration of 0.2% is required.

Stability
Highly susceptible to degradation via oxidation and UV exposure; requires opaque, airtight packaging. Sensitive to thermal stress which may trigger polymerization of phenolic components.

Safety Profile
Contains thujone (alpha and beta), which is subject to strict regulatory limits due to potential neurotoxicity. While safe in topical cosmetic applications within recommended limits, it is typically restricted in fragrance concentrates to under 0.8%.
